Operational Support Manager
Job Title:
Manager, Operational Support.
Position Overview:
The Operational Support Manager is responsible for overseeing and optimizing operational support functions and managing the fleet of vehicles within an organization across multiple facilities. This role involves leading a team of support staff and ensuring efficient coordination of various operational activities to maintain smooth business operations. Additionally, the Operational Support Manager is tasked with managing the fleet, including vehicle acquisition, maintenance, compliance, and safety, to ensure reliable and cost-effective transportation services.
- Lead and supervise a team of managers and operational support staff, providing guidance, training, and performance evaluations.
- Identify areas for operational improvement and develop strategies to enhance efficiency, productivity, and service quality.
- Monitor and manage operational processes to meet organizational objectives and service level targets.
- Ensure exceptional customer service is provided to both internal and external stakeholders.
- Oversee the organization's fleet of vehicles, including vans, trucks, or other specialized vehicles.
- Assist team with development and implementation of fleet management policies and procedures to ensure optimal vehicle utilization, maintenance, and safety.
- Oversee coordination of vehicle acquisition, disposal, and replacement strategies to meet operational requirements efficiently.
- Ensure all vehicle maintenance schedules are monitored and all vehicles are in compliance with safety and regulatory standards.
- Collaborate with drivers and other stakeholders to address any fleet-related issues promptly.
- Ensure their team is maintaining accurate inventory of all tools and equipment ensuring stock levels meet ongoing demands
- Oversee the implementation of inventory control measures to present loss or theft, that tooling needs are identified based on project requirements and department requests and that tools are standardized across divisions ensuring they are fit for purpose and that tooling procurement activities are implemented and tracked.
- Create standard procedures for facilities across all locations
- Ensure their teams are maintaining facilities, completing necessary repairs and standards of cleanliness are maintained
- Oversee the coordination and scheduling of regular inspections and preventative maintenance
- Assist planning and lead construction of new facilities both Hub and Spoke
- Analyze operational data and fleet metrics to identify trends, assess performance, and make data-driven decisions.
- Prepare and present regular reports to management, highlighting key performance indicators related to operational support and fleet management.
- Participate in the development and management of budgets related to operational support and fleet management.
- Monitor fleet-related expenditures and identify cost-saving opportunities without compromising safety and service quality.
- Collaborate with vendors and suppliers to ensure seamless integration of services and monitor their performance.
- Negotiate contracts and service level agreements to achieve cost-effectiveness and high-quality services.
- Ensure compliance with company policies, industry regulations, and safety standards in all aspects of fleet operations.
- Implement and maintain procedures to ensure consistent service delivery and regulatory compliance.
- Coordinate and provide training programs for the operational support team and drivers to enhance their skills and knowledge.
- Ensure that the fleet staff receives appropriate safety and compliance training.
-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Operations Management, or a related field. Advanced degrees or certifications in relevant disciplines are advantageous.
- Proven experience in operational support management of multiple facilities and fleet management.
- Strong leadership and team management skills with the ability to motivate and inspire a diverse workforce.
- Excellent problem-solving abilities and a track record of implementing process improvements.
- Analytical mindset with the capability to interpret data and make informed decisions.
- Outstanding communication and interpersonal skills to interact effectively with stakeholders at all levels.
- Knowledge of fleet management software and tools for efficient fleet tracking and maintenance.
- Understanding of transportation regulations, compliance, and best practices.
- Flexibility to adapt to changing business requirements and work schedules.
- Primarily performs work in an office, warehouse, and facility environment with frequent movement between locations.
